Über diesen Titel

In the steamy third novel in the Silver Pines Ranch series, a newly appointed sheriff and a congressman's daughter must keep their impulsive Vegas nuptials hidden to protect their reputations—but what happens in Vegas rarely remains secret.

Her heart is wild. Only he can capture it.

When Cole Ashby is appointed Laurel Creek's interim sheriff, he is determined to prove himself as the best man for the job. A devoted single dad, his goal is to lay steady roots for his young daughter.

As the daughter of a Kentucky congressman, Ginger Danforth's life has always been about neat appearances. But inside, she's dying to break free and embrace the sense of adventure that runs through her veins.

During a wild weekend in Las Vegas, Ginger and Cole play a game of truth or dare and, after a few too many drinks, find themselves hitched in a neon-lit chapel. With no quick way out, they strike a deal: stay secretly married until Ginger's father is reelected and Cole lands the sheriff job permanently.

But as the pair are forced to spend an increasing amount of time in each other's company, sparks continue to fly, and their accidental marriage starts to feel dangerously real.

Until they forget they were ever pretending at all.

First, let’s talk about the audiobook….perfection. Thomas Oakley’s warm, steady voice brought Cole to life in a way that felt entirely fitting, while Erin Mallon was the perfect Ginger, full of energy, charm, and sweetness. These two narrators are among my favorites, and their chemistry added an extra layer to an already heartfelt story.

As expected from Paisley Hope—and in line with the first two books in the Silver Pines Ranch series—Riding the High had me hooked from the start. I was a total goner. Cole and Ginger’s story was everything I could have hoped for and more. These are the kind of characters you root for from page one, and their journey was both heartwarming and refreshingly mature.

Paisley Hope continues to shine with her signature mix of flirty banter, strong friendships, and romantic chemistry that builds naturally. The “flanter” between Ginger and Cole is sassy and fun, and their dynamic evolves beautifully from a platonic bond into something deeply romantic. The accidental marriage trope is handled with charm, and rather than leaning into overdone drama, the story finds its strength in genuine connection and communication.

One of my favorite things about Paisley’s writing—especially evident in this book—is the way her characters talk to each other like grown-ups. There’s no dramatic third-act breakup or frustrating miscommunication just to keep the plot moving. Instead, we get emotional honesty, real vulnerability, and characters who care about understanding each other. Cole in particular shines here, handling every difficult conversation with maturity and openness.

If I had one lingering question, it’s why Ginger was “off-limits” for Cole when he’d loved her for so long. That piece felt a bit unclear, though it didn’t take away from how satisfying their journey was overall.

Great narration of a slow-burn romance with humor, heart, and adults who actually act like adults
